You should be getting your graded midterm back thursday (18th). You were talking past each other because of this. Instrumentally good: something is good because of its consequences. It is only good as a means to an end. Intrinsically good: we want it for the sake of itself. (e. g. listening to music). You are not doing it for what it gets you: both combined: something is good for its own sake and for what it gets you.
